Unlike theadministrator nonrenewal statute which allows school boards to enter into two-year contracts with principals, and even have extensions to those contracts, theteacher contract statute only allows schools boards to enter into one-year contracts with teachers. In the context of term contracts, the commissioner has stated that good cause is the employees failure to perform the duties in the scope of employment that a person of ordinary prudence would have done under the same or similar circumstances. The good cause required for a mid-contract termination is a higher standard than the pre-established reasons for nonrenewal set forth in the districts local nonrenewal policy. Wisconsin Statute 118.22 sets forth the minimum and mandatory procedural requirements for nonrenewal of a fulltime teachers individual contract. April is an important month because thestatutory nonrenewal timelines, at the latest, start in April with the preliminary notice of nonrenewal which must be given at least 15 days prior to May 15, or April 30. PDF School Principals and Teacher Contract Non-Renewal - ed The statute requires that the preliminary notice inform the teacher that the board is considering nonrenewal of the teacher's contract and that, if the teacher files a request with the board within five days after receiving the preliminary notice, the teacher has the right to a private conference with the board prior to being given final written notice of nonrenewal. Even though it was a shock at first, it led to a much better opportunity long-term. It is important to note that the law mandates that, No teacher may be employed or dismissed except by a majority vote of the full membership of the board. Thus, it is best practice to schedule the private conference on a date when a majority of the full board can meet and act on issuing a final notice of nonrenewal.
